/*
 * @test
 * @bug 8267118
 * @summary Test catching Throwable doesn't trigger OOME
 * @requires vm.flagless
 * @library /test/lib
 * @run driver TestCatchThrowableOOM
 */

import java.util.HashMap;
import jdk.test.lib.process.OutputAnalyzer;
import jdk.test.lib.process.ProcessTools;

public class TestCatchThrowableOOM {

    private static String[] expected = new String[] {
        "Test starting ...",
        "Test complete",
        "Exception <a 'java/lang/OutOfMemoryError'", // from logging
    };

    public static void main(String[] args) throws Throwable {
        ProcessBuilder pb = ProcessTools.createJavaProcessBuilder("-Xmx64m",
                                                                  "-Xlog:exceptions=trace",

                                                                  "TestCatchThrowableOOM$OOM");
        OutputAnalyzer output = new OutputAnalyzer(pb.start());
        output.shouldHaveExitValue(0);
        for (String msg : expected) {
            output.shouldContain(msg);
        }
    }

    static class OOM {
        private static HashMap<Object, Object> store = new HashMap<>();
        public static void main(String[] args) {
            System.out.println(expected[0]);
            try {
                // Keep adding entries until we throw OOME
                while (true) {
                    Object o = new Byte[100 * 1024];
                    store.put(o, o);
                }
            } catch (Throwable oome) {
                store = null;
                System.gc(); // Just for good measure
                System.out.println(expected[1]);
            }
        }
    }
}
